FineUI 官方论坛

标题: extaspnet grid 绑定大数据量很卡,出错 [打印本页]

作者: 卧龍    时间: 2012-10-5 02:20
标题: extaspnet grid 绑定大数据量很卡,出错

作者: 夏雨雪(joe)    时间: 2012-10-6 02:36
分页处理,但一页也不能超过100条,否则也超慢!

确实是个非常大的问题,控件比较多的时候,也非常慢!

比较郁闷的和不是满意的地方!
作者: 卧龍    时间: 2012-10-6 07:23
我每页才20条,采用数据库分页,但是点排序要等上几分钟才反应,IE假死
作者: 大鸟打小鸟    时间: 2012-10-6 16:09
这个应该不会,你先在SSMS里面运行下SQL看看是不是卡,如果卡的话,你应该就要去建索引了!不然你贴出你的SQL查询语句看看到底是什么问题
作者: 卧龍    时间: 2012-10-7 15:00
select * from custormer
肯定建了索引,如果你们不会有这个情况的话,麻烦传你们的项目给我试试!
作者: 大鸟打小鸟    时间: 2012-10-7 16:34
你这样,数据库里面这样写SQL
with t as
(
SELECT ROW_NUMBER() OVER (ORDER BY "你排序的列活着用(SELECT 0)") AS RowNumber ,* FROM Customer AS tb
)

SELECT * FROM t WHERE RowNumber BETWEEN 你要的页码 AND 你要的页码+你一页显示的数据条数-1

这样直接在数据库里分页取数据,可以减轻很大负担,你试试看
作者: 夏雨雪(joe)    时间: 2012-10-7 16:42
分页显示的情况下,每页20条,不会慢的。如果每页超过100条,就比较慢了。

同时,在添加数据的form里面,控件比较多的情况,页面打开会很慢。

这个是我比较头疼的地方,性能影响用户体验。
作者: 7107135    时间: 2012-10-8 07:43
数据库分页
作者: P.Yang    时间: 2012-10-10 10:32
卧龍 发表于 2012-10-6 07:23
我每页才20条,采用数据库分页,但是点排序要等上几分钟才反应,IE假死

仁兄,你都知道用数据库分页,干嘛又不用数据库排序呢?????????
作者: 卧龍    时间: 2012-10-10 12:40
我是按照例子做排序的,请问数据库排序什么弄
作者: P.Yang    时间: 2012-10-11 04:39
卧龍 发表于 2012-10-10 12:40
我是按照例子做排序的,请问数据库排序什么弄

数据库排序,你百度一下不就出来了吗!




欢迎光临 FineUI 官方论坛 (https://fineui.com/BBS/) Powered by Discuz! X3.4